Problems:

Calculate the pH of a buffer solution:

Containing 0.015 M acetic acid and 0.035 M sodium acetate.

The same solution as in part a) after enough HC l has been added to establish a Cl-concentration of 0.001 M.

Where: KA=1.8*10-5

For the carbonate system in pure water, what species dominates at the typical pH encountered in natural water sources?

A sample of water collected in the field had a pH of 6.8. By the time it was analyzed in the lab, the pH had decreased to 6.0. Give apossible explanation.

For a water sample with a bicarbonate ion concentration of 50 mg/L and a CO2 content of 30 mg/L:

Find the pH &

Find the pH if CO2 is reduced by aeration to only 3 mg/L.
